Why AI Skills Matter for Nepal's Job Market

Nepal's tech workforce has historically been a talent exporter — graduates move to India, the Gulf, or Europe. AI is changing that equation. Outsourcing firms in Lalitpur and Kathmandu are increasingly winning contracts for data annotation, prompt engineering, and ML pipeline work that requires AI literacy. Remittance-funded families are also funding more upskilling than ever before.

The practical upshot: you don't need to leave Nepal to get an AI job. You need credentials that a remote employer in Singapore, the UK, or the US will recognize. That means internationally recognized certificates — primarily from Coursera (tied to universities like DeepLearning.AI and IBM) or specialist platforms.

Which AI roles are hiring remotely from Nepal?

  • AI prompt engineer — writing and testing prompts for LLM-based products. Entry-level, high demand, fully remote.
  • Data annotation specialist — labeling training data for AI models. Many firms hire from Nepal specifically.
  • Business intelligence analyst with AI tools — using generative AI to speed up BI reporting. Strong demand in Nepal's banking and telecom sector.
  • Customer support AI trainer — building and improving chatbot flows. Growing in Nepal's BPO sector.
  • Machine learning engineer — harder to break into without a CS degree, but possible with the right Coursera specialization + portfolio.

How to Access Courses from Nepal

Payment is the most common friction point for Nepali learners. Here's what actually works:

Coursera Financial Aid

Coursera's financial aid program is available to Nepali learners and covers up to 100% of course fees. The application takes about 15 minutes and is approved in roughly two weeks. Answer honestly about your income situation — Nepal's income levels almost always qualify. This is the most common way Nepali learners access Coursera specializations.

Coursera Plus

If you have an international debit or credit card (NIC Asia, Global IME, and Nabil Bank all issue Visa cards usable internationally), Coursera Plus at ~$59/month gives you unlimited access. At that rate, completing a 3-month specialization costs roughly NPR 24,000 total — comparable to one month of a local bootcamp.

Udemy Sales

Udemy runs discounts to NPR 499-999 per course multiple times a month. Never pay full price. If you see a course full-priced, wait 48-72 hours.

Nepal Telecom / connectivity

Video-heavy courses work fine on Nepal's current 4G and fiber infrastructure in Kathmandu, Pokhara, and most district headquarters. If you're in a bandwidth-limited area, Coursera allows video download for offline viewing on mobile.

AI Education at Nepal's Universities vs Online

Tribhuvan University, Kathmandu University, and Pokhara University all offer some form of AI or data science content within their CS programs. The honest assessment:

  • University programs: Strong theory, weak tooling. Professors are often 2-3 years behind industry. Good for a foundational degree, not for rapid AI upskilling.
  • Local bootcamps (Deerwalk, Islington, various): Range wildly in quality. Some are excellent; many are outdated Python tutorials rebranded as "AI courses." Ask to see the syllabus and instructor credentials before paying.
  • Online international courses: Best for current tools (GPT-4, LangChain, cloud ML platforms), internationally recognized certificates, and self-paced learning that fits around a job. The clear winner for career outcomes.

The optimal path for most Nepali learners: a local university degree for the credential, combined with 2-3 Coursera specializations for the actual skills employers test in interviews.

FAQ

Can I learn AI in Nepal without a programming background?

Yes, for many AI roles. Prompt engineering, AI content creation, business intelligence with AI tools, and customer support AI training require minimal coding. If you want to become a machine learning engineer, you'll need Python — but that's learnable online in 3-4 months before starting an ML specialization.

Are Coursera certificates recognized by Nepali employers?

Increasingly yes, especially by IT companies, banks, and international outsourcing firms operating in Nepal. A DeepLearning.AI or IBM AI certificate on your CV is recognized by any technical hiring manager. For government or university jobs, a local degree still carries more weight.

What does an AI course in Nepal cost?

Local bootcamps range from NPR 20,000 to NPR 150,000 for a multi-month course. Online via Coursera financial aid: free. Via Coursera Plus: roughly NPR 7,000-8,000/month. Via Udemy (on sale): NPR 499-999 per course. The international online options are dramatically cheaper and generally better quality.

How long does it take to complete an AI specialization?

Most Coursera specializations are designed for 3-6 months at 5-10 hours per week. Working professionals in Nepal typically take 4-5 months. If you're studying full-time, you can complete a specialization in 6-8 weeks.

Is there a free AI course option from Nepal?

Yes. Coursera's audit mode lets you access most course materials for free — you only pay if you want the certificate. For a certificate, use financial aid (also effectively free if approved). Google also offers free AI fundamentals courses that are worth doing before starting a paid specialization.

Which AI skill has the best salary outlook in Nepal right now?

Business intelligence with generative AI tools, followed by ML engineering. BI analysts with AI skills are seeing 30-50% salary premiums at Nepal's banks and telecom companies. ML engineers with cloud experience (AWS, GCP) are being hired directly by international companies at international rates — the most lucrative path but the most demanding to qualify for.
